Gov. Healey prioritized affordability, announcing housing, energy, and healthcare plans while launching her reelection bid.
Massachusetts Governor Maura Healey, in her 2026 State of the Commonwealth address, made affordability the central focus, criticizing federal policies under President Trump for increasing housing, energy, and healthcare costs. She announced plans to build 220,000 homes by 2035, expand down payment assistance, and lower mortgage rates. A new hydropower connection from Quebec is expected to save $50 million on energy bills. Healey also proposed banning medical debt from credit reports, eliminating prior authorization for many treatments, and restricting social media use by minors with age verification and parental consent. She condemned federal immigration enforcement tactics, highlighted protections for vulnerable communities, and launched her reelection campaign emphasizing state-led action against national challenges.
